About Prof. John Cook
Biographical Summary
"John Cook, born 1st Sept. 1807, son of John C, D.D., Professor of Biblical Criticism, Univ. of St Andrews ; educated at Univ. there; M.A. (1823); app. factor to St Mary's College in 1824 ; licen. by Presb. of Fordoun 13th Aug. 1828; ord. to Laurencekirk 3rd Sept. 1829 ; trans, to St Leonard's 2nd Oct. 1845 ; D.D. (St Andrews, 9th Dec. 1848) ; app. Convener of General Assembly's Committee on Education 4th June 1849, of that for Improving the Condition of Parish Schoolmasters 3rd June 1850, of that on Aids to Devotion 1st June 1857, of that for Army and Navy Chaplains 1859, and of that on Impressions of the Scriptures, Catechisms, etc., 3rd June 1861 ; elected Moderator of the General Assembly 19th May 1859 ; assessor for the Council of the Univ. on University Court that year ; pres. by Queen Victoria 17th May, and adm. to this Chair 15th June 1860 ; app. one of the Deans of the Chapel Royal 1863; dera. 30th July 1868; died 17th April 1869. A memorial window to him was erected by the parishioners in the College Church. He marr. 9th May 1837, Rachel Susan (born 15th June 1812, died 25th June 1894), daugh. of William Farquhar, London, and had issue —
- Elizabeth, born 13th May 1838 (marr. (1) John Robertson, D.D., min. of St Mungo's, Glasgow : (2) Matthew Rodger, D.D., min. of St Leonard's)
- Isabella Farquhar, born 14th March 1841, died 21st May 1894
- Harriett, born 6th June 1843, died 19th May 1869
- Madeline, born 17th Dec. 1845, (marr. Duncan Maclennan), died 17th June 1869
- Rachel Susan, born 1st Feb. 1848 (marr. 20th May 1874, Charles Prestwick Scott, editor of the Manchester Guardian), died Nov. 1905
- Marcia Sophia(marr. Andrew Stewart)."
SOURCE: Fasti ecclesiae scoticanae: the succession of ministers in the Church of Scotland from the reformation, Vol. VII, page 433
John was a Minister, Church of Scotland and Professor of Ecclesiastical History, University of St Andrews.
